ORDER
Upon consideration of the motions to govern filed in No. 07-1336, No. 07-1414, and No. 07-1415; the motion to hold No. 07- 1336 and No. 07-1414 in abeyance; and the motions to dismiss No. 07-1415, the order to show cause issued December 26, 2007 in No. 07-1415, and the absence of any objection to the dismissal of No. 07-1415, it is
ORDERED that the order to show cause be discharged. It is
FURTHER ORDERED that No. 07-1415 be dismissed. It is
FURTHER ORDERED that the motion to hold No. 07-1336 and No. 07-1414 in abeyance be dismissed as moot. It is
FURTHER ORDERED that the parties submit, within 30 days of the date of this order, proposed formats for the briefing of these cases. The parties are strongly urged to submit a joint proposal and are reminded that the court looks with extreme disfavor on repetitious submissions and will, where appropriate, require a joint brief of aligned parties with total words not to exceed the standard allotment for a single brief. The parties are directed to provide detailed justifications for any request to file separate briefs or to exceed in the aggregate the standard word allotment. Requests to exceed the standard word allotment must specify the word allotment necessary for each issue.
The Clerk is directed to issue forthwith to the agency a certified copy of this order in lieu of formal mandate in No. 07-1415.
